Since 1990, Cambridge Judge Business School (CJBS) has forged a reputation as a centre of rigorous thinking and high-impact transformative education, situated within one of the world's most prestigious research universities, and in the heart of the Cambridge Cluster, the most successful technology entrepreneurship cluster in Europe.

Cambridge Judge Business School has a world-class faculty, representing all continents, whose research interests span the globe and the full spectrum of business issues. Many are leaders in their field, directing cutting-edge research and consulting for businesses and government. As part of one of the world's leading universities, CJBS is home to one of the largest concentrations of interdisciplinary business and management research in Europe.

The Information and Library Services team plays a vital role in supporting this academic community. We provide access to a wide range of electronic resources in business and management - including e-journals, e-books, market research, news, and company data - via the Information Centre website. These resources are heavily used by students, faculty, and staff across all programmes.

We are seeking a proactive and adaptable individual to join us as Deputy Information and Library Services Manager on a temporary basis. In this role, you will:

  • Oversee the day-to-day operations of the Information Centre
  • Supervise and support the work of the team
  • Coordinate the circulation system and maintain physical collections
  • Work closely with the Information & Library Services Manager to deliver a high-quality service (and deputise for them as required).

The ideal candidate will have:

  • Experience with electronic resources, reference services, collection development, and cataloguing
  • Proven ability to develop and deliver training sessions/presentations
  • Excellent interpersonal and managerial skills
  • Creative and practical approach to problem-solving
  • Business knowledge or experience is desirable but not essential

This is a temporary cover position for up to one year, or until the return of the substantive post holder, whichever is sooner.
